Description
We are looking for an Infrastructure Support Specialist to provide technical and operational support in high-availability enterprise environments. This role is focused on supporting network and communications infrastructure, troubleshooting incidents, maintaining connectivity services, and collaborating with local, remote, and global technical teams. The ideal candidate has solid experience in network operations, Cisco environments, incident resolution, and support processes within corporate or mission-critical environments. This is a remote, full-time position for professionals based in Latin America . Advanced English is required and will be assessed during the interview process. Responsibilities Provide remote technical support for network and communications infrastructure. Diagnose and resolve incidents related to LAN/WAN networks, connectivity, and networking equipment. Support local and remote teams with configuration, upgrade, and maintenance activities. Collaborate with network engineers, global operations teams, clients, vendors, and cross-functional stakeholders. Perform advanced troubleshooting using packet capture tools and protocol analysis. Monitor network infrastructure performance using large-scale monitoring and management tools. Manage incidents, problems, and changes following ITIL best practices. Create and maintain technical documentation, operating procedures, and support records. Prioritize multiple simultaneous incidents while meeting established SLAs. Communicate technical concepts clearly to both technical and non-technical users. Requirements Technical degree or studies in Management Information Systems, Computer Science, Business Administration, Communications, or a related field. 3 to 5 years of experience in infrastructure support, network operations, or similar roles. Hands-on experience configuring, administering, and troubleshooting Cisco equipment. Strong knowledge of LAN/WAN networks, TCP/IP protocols, networking technologies, and the OSI model. Experience configuring and troubleshooting Cisco switches and routers. CCNA certification or equivalent knowledge is highly valued. Experience using traffic capture tools and network protocol analysis tools. Experience with large-scale network monitoring and administration tools. Knowledge of ITIL processes, including Incident Management, Problem Management, and Change Management. Strong analytical skills and ability to solve complex technical issues. Ability to work under pressure and manage multiple priorities. Excellent verbal and written communication skills in English. Ability to interact with clients, vendors, managers, engineers, and stakeholders at different levels. Service-oriented mindset, attention to detail, and strong follow-through. Availability Availability to participate in a 24x7 support operation. Ability to respond to incidents within established SLAs, with expected response times between 4 and 8 hours. Previous experience with on-call rotations, critical support, or standby support is a strong plus. Stable internet connection and an adequate remote work setup. Benefits Remote work from Latin America. Full-time engagement, 40 hours per week. Opportunity to work in enterprise-level infrastructure environments. Exposure to global teams and mission-critical network operations. Collaboration with HITSS and the final client through a structured selection process. Long-term professional growth in infrastructure, networking, and technical support operations.
